Importing into Encore reduces quality
by James Owens on Nov 3, 2009 at 2:34:31 am

I'm a film student and all year I’ve had the same work flow:

1) Export clips from After Effects as QT movies using the 'Animation' codec (I don’t have Dynamic Link)
2) Import into Encore to build DVD

and everything's been fine until now, when my assignment is due of cause.

What's happening is now when I import my clips into Encore, the quality dramatically reduces to a point where it's unusable.
I've tried exporting from AE with the Sorenson codec (and some others but I don’t remember) with the same results: rubbish quality.
My composition settings are: D1/DV PAL, 4:3.

I can't figure out how to stop this from happening, can you help?
